KellyClaude Introduction
KellyClaude (KELLYCLAUDE) represents a groundbreaking fusion of AI technology and cryptocurrency. Designed around the AI agent “KellyClaude”, conceptualized by Austen Allred, this token serves as a medium for transactions on the Basechain platform. Its primary transaction aim is connecting through @bankrbot on the X platform, aiming to create streamlined financial strategies by rerouting transaction fees back to the creator, Austen Allred.

How Does KellyClaude Crypto Work?
The operational backbone of KellyClaude relies on its smart contract, deployed through @bankrbot on the X platform. This system allows KellyClaude to leverage automated strategies to direct and redistribute transactional fees among users. The AI agent, KellyClaude, ensures transparency and efficiency, promoting seamless interactions within its ecosystem, primarily on the Basechain.
